The wrestling world lost an all-time great in Jay Briscoe earlier this week. The Ring of Honor veteran tragically passed away in a car accident on Tuesday evening. His two daughters were involved in the car wreck as well. Thankfully, they survived the accident.

Michael Cole paid his respect to Jay Briscoe live on air during WWE SmackDown last night. The veteran commentator acknowledged The Briscoes as one of the greatest tag teams in professional wrestling.

SmackDown star Top Dolla gave a shoutout to The Briscoes after the show as well. The Hit Row member referenced The Briscoes’ “Reach for the Sky” catchphrase during a WWE Digital Exclusive interview with Cathy Kelley.

“I’m from where Dem Boys mask up until you reach for the sky.”

Hit Row won the first round of the SmackDown Team Titles Number One Contender’s Tournament last night. Top Dolla and Ashante Adonis will take on Banger Bros. (Drew McIntyre and Sheamus) in the tournament semifinals next Friday. You can read the complete line-up here.
